Transaction 75af4766e9bc82525e8e63ca15ff1bba45629dad7e9dfc42a9a0a23f23835ee0

1 Input
2 Outputs
  • 75af4766e9bc82525e8e63ca15ff1bba45629dad7e9dfc42a9a0a23f23835ee0:0
  • value  24250000
    address  1dGTCHBCdcnFegLJmEPDbb8XbJ5wiUT3R
  • 75af4766e9bc82525e8e63ca15ff1bba45629dad7e9dfc42a9a0a23f23835ee0:1
  • value  163083180
    address  19xuKwgfphk3mMaN7TEYYYULLou671KxfC